THEIR PROBLEMS … ARE MY PROBLEMS TOO...!
Staying in rented accommodation can be an adventure and at the same time a real learning. I am quite sure that people who have experienced this alternative would have gathered many memories for a lifetime. The surprise visit from the Landlord, the fight for water, addition to rent without notice, loud music, trash spilled over… and the list of events goes on.
During one of my stays in rental accommodation, the experience was a different one. I was among the 3 tenants on the ground floor of the house with a separate entry and exit. There was total freedom by the owner and there was no intervention whatsoever in any form. The best part was the down-to-earth attitude of the owner of the house who would take special interest in maintaining the cleanliness of the premises. All three of us had clear cut-bifurcation in terms of electricity, water and vehicle parking. Except for the UPS.. the power back-up!
Though power cuts were not frequent during the beginning of summer, the UPS was a must and should requirement during the summer season when the humidity levels would shoot to the extreme. However, the real problem crept in on a night when the power cut continued for more than 4 hours and the UPS died down after discharging the entire backup. Since the other two tenants were pursuing their graduation, the usage of laptops and other devices drained the UPS in total. That Night was a sleepless night without a fan and light for all three tenants. Somehow the night passed by and the next day the other two tenants were seen complaining with hues and cries to the owner of the house about the UPS and urging the owner to replace the same with the new one. I too was summoned by the owner of the house for a common discussion about how to handle the UPS crisis. For a moment I felt that all three of us would be drilled with left-right encounters for not handling the situation properly. However, the owner was very patient in replying to the annoyed tenants and advised them to use only limited appliances/gadgets when there is a power cut as it would help the UPS last for a bit longer than usual. I found her answer to be quite sensible and all the three went back to our places.
But the real drama was yet to happen! The power cuts in our location became too rampant and the UPS dying down was quite frequent. Both the youngsters started using more and more electronic gadgets and appliances during the power cut and the UPS did not even last for 2 hours during the power breakdown. The situation crossed all the limits when the UPS would die down immediately giving a backup of 30-45 minutes. I realized that these two tenants were deliberately using their laptops along with lights and fans on, just to gratify their ego and in this context, all three including me had to bear the unfavorable consequence. I was totally furious with the narrow-minded behaviour of these two and decided to talk to them collectively. I told them that the UPS was a common resource, and everyone should use it wisely. If we use the same with little sensitivity all three could manage the power-cuts without causing much disruption.
The immediate reply from them was “We pay the rent on time and will use the resources as we want. You too, can use any appliances or gadgets you want during the power cut. You not using the UPS is not our headache. Your problem is not our problem!”????
I did not feel like continuing the conversation and left the place and was just rethinking what these two people had concluded - Your problem is not our problem!
I thought of appraising the Owner of the house with the current challenge that I was facing because of the irresponsible behaviour of my co-tenants. But then I realized that she would not interfere in this matter as it was between the tenants and a matter of less relevance.
As I lay down on the bed gazing at the fan, a lot of thoughts started flowing across my mind.
How can someone be so arrogant? I need to teach these youngsters a strong lesson. Its high time even I start using all the appliances and gadgets during the power cut deliberately. And make sure that the UPS dries down in no time. Even the owner of the house must be made to realize her folly of selecting the wrong tenants. Yes, this was the best option to take these hardheaded people to task.
After reassuring myself that this was the best alternative, I was now waiting for power cut so that I could execute this plan.
Suddenly another thought started flowing in my mind…..
Who will be the most affected individual once I materialize this strategy?

My co-tenants? Definitely Yes…They won't be able to use any of their appliances or gadgets. And this serves them right.
Is it going to be the owner of the house? Yes. She should have taken some serious action against the tenants for their indiscipline.
And finally, somewhere my thought process stopped at a point where I had to question myself…
Will this cheap strategy of mine damage me somehow? ………..
Yes…….. I would be equally affected by this low-level thinking as I too would have to suffer equally along with the co-tenants sitting in the darkness. Darkness which was self-created by me!
How foolish I was to follow my malicious intention of tanning/whipping someone's hide?
Chasing our dreams …rushing through different phases of our life.. we have become too busy focusing on the ‘self’ while ignoring the individuals around us. We work with a strong belief that ‘your problems are not my problems’ and enjoy a peculiar glee when we see others in trouble. This kind of self-seeking attitude is the reason for a hostile environment in the current scenario. In modern times where the entire success of the organization is attributed to team cohesiveness and team dynamics, failure to uplift and provide support to peers can be very damaging to the business in the long run. Supporting individuals through their tough times can have great results creating a unique value in a holistic way.
Be it the personal or professional boundary that we work in, at the end of the day, all we need is to understand one simple thing:
Their Problems … Are My Problem Too..!
